But seriously. This is the 10th or 11th time you've asked about wood recommendations. And every single time you've been told that it doesn't matter.
Even the most die-hard of tonewood believers will tell you that you can use -any tonewood- for -any genre-.
The differences, at dead most, are still so subtle that a change in pickups or EQ will completely engulf them.
Pick the wood that looks prettiest to you or that you have the most connection with.
